Original Description
Johannes Hermanus Koekkoek Snr's Looking Out To Sea (19th century) exemplifies Dutch Romantic marine painting at its finest. The dramatic composition depicts turbulent waves crashing against sailing ships, rendered with meticulous detail. Koekkoek masterfully captures the raw power of nature—stormy skies swirl above the choppy sea, while the ships' billowing sails and tilted masts convey the struggle against the elements. The work reflects the 19th-century European fascination with sublime seascapes, showcasing the artist's profound understanding of maritime lighting and atmospheric effects. As a leading figure of the Koekkoek dynasty—a prominent Dutch artistic family—Johannes Snr played a pivotal role in preserving traditional marine painting techniques while inspiring his more famous son, Johannes Junior. The painting represents an important bridge between Dutch Golden Age seascapes and later Impressionist treatments of maritime subjects.
